Permutations worksheets for Grade 12 students available through Wayground provide comprehensive practice with advanced counting principles and arrangement problems that are essential for college-level mathematics preparation. These expertly crafted resources strengthen students' abilities to calculate the number of ways objects can be arranged when order matters, distinguish between permutations and combinations, and apply permutation formulas to solve complex real-world scenarios. The worksheet collections include step-by-step practice problems that progress from basic permutation calculations to advanced applications involving restrictions, circular arrangements, and repeated elements, with complete answer keys that allow students to verify their understanding and identify areas needing additional focus. Available as free printables in convenient pdf format, these resources ensure students master the fundamental concepts of permutations while building confidence in their problem-solving abilities.
